About Seafood combo

Seafood Combo is a delectable dish typically inspired by coastal cuisines, featuring a blend of fresh seafood such as shrimp, fish fillets, scallops, and crab. Often seasoned with herbs and spices, it may be grilled, baked, or sautéed, occasionally accompanied by sides like roasted vegetables or rice. Rich in high-quality protein, omega-3 fatty acids, and several vitamins and minerals, it's a heart-healthy choice that supports brain function and overall well-being. The cooking method can influence its nutritional profile—grilled or roasted options tend to be lower in fat compared to fried versions. Some preparations may include buttery sauces or heavy breading, which add flavor but may increase calorie and saturated fat content. Opting for lighter, veggie-infused variations enhances its health benefits while preserving the bold and satisfying mix of seafood flavors.
